Electric buses usually require more than a standard flatbed. Depending on overall height, axle weight, and deck clearance, the move may call for RGNs, lowboys, step decks, double drops, or multi-axle trailers. Battery packs and roof-mounted systems can raise the center of gravity, so trailer selection matters as much as route selection. If the bus is especially tall or wide, a lower deck profile may be the safer fit. Heavy Haulers evaluate each unit against the trailer’s deck height, loading angle, and axle spread before dispatch. Heavy Haulers also account for securement points, suspension travel, and the need for blocking or cribbing during road transport. For larger transit buses, a multi-axle setup can help distribute weight and stay within road limits. Heavy Haul Transporting matches the trailer to the specific bus dimensions rather than forcing a one-size-fits-all solution. That approach helps protect the cargo while staying within Washington oversize rules and the planned route profile.
Washington oversize permits can involve width, height, length, and weight review, especially when an electric bus leaves Port of Olympia, WA and heads toward Interstate 5, US-101, State Route 8, or regional arterials around Olympia and Tacoma. Bridge clearances, lane widths, construction zones, and turning radii all affect the route. If the load exceeds threshold dimensions, escort vehicles may be required, and travel windows may be limited to avoid peak traffic. Heavy Haulers review the route before the truck rolls, including overhead obstructions, interchange geometry, and any local restrictions near the port corridor. Heavy Haulers also coordinate around state permit requirements and any escort rules tied to the load’s size. Heavy Haul Transporting builds the move around the actual route, not a generic map, because electric buses can be long, tall, and awkward through urban exits. That level of planning helps reduce surprises once the bus leaves the terminal and enters public roads.

Electric buses may move on RGNs, lowboys, step decks, double drops, or multi-axle trailers. The right choice depends on height, weight, wheelbase, and securement points. Battery placement and roof equipment can also affect deck clearance and loading angle, so each move is reviewed individually.
Often yes. Many electric buses exceed standard height, length, or weight thresholds, so Washington oversize permits may be required. Route limits, bridge clearances, and travel windows also matter. We review those details before dispatch so the move follows the correct state rules.
Yes, depending on the bus’s dimensions and the route. Wider or taller loads may need one or more escorts, especially on tighter corridors or near urban interchanges. Escort needs are determined by permit conditions and the actual path from Port of Olympia, WA to the destination.
They are long, tall, and heavy, and the battery systems can affect weight balance and center of gravity. That means trailer selection, securement, and route planning all matter. Bridge clearances, turning space, and road geometry also need review before the truck leaves the port area.
